Synfig Studio is described as 'Synfig is a free and open-source, industrial-strength, vector-based 2D animation app designed for producing feature-film animations' and is a very popular Animation Maker in the photos & graphics category. There are more than 50 alternatives to Synfig Studio for a variety of platforms, including Windows, Mac, Linux, Web-based and Android apps. The best Synfig Studio alternative is Krita, which is both free and Open Source. Other great apps like Synfig Studio are Animation Desk, OpenToonz, Glaxnimate and Pencil2D.

libavg is a high-level development platform for media-centric applications.
libavg allows programmers, media artists and designers to quickly develop media applications. It uses python as scripting language, is written in high-speed C++ and uses modern OpenGL for display output.
